The DS and DS Lite have a port for Game Boy and Game Boy Advance games. Opera comes with a cartridge to put in that port, which gives Opera more RAM to store webpages.

If you buy the regular version, i think it'll still work on the DS Lite, but a bit of the cartridge will stick out, but if you buy the DS Lite version, that little bit wont stick out.
